Meet the PA animator behind Scavengers Reign • Spotlight PA
Aug 16, 2024 · “Stunningly original.” “A triumph of imagination. ” “Uniquely thrilling. Scavengers Reign, an animated sci-fi series, debuted on Max in 2023 to huge critical acclaim.It’s now nominated for an Emmy alongside X-Men ’97, The Simpsons, Blue Eye Samurai, and Bob’s Burgers.. The show was co-created by Charles Huettner, an Adams County-based animator.

Stacy Garrity wins PA treasurer race • Spotlight PA
Nov 6, 2024 · The seat has been a springboard for higher office. Democrat Bob Casey served as state treasurer before running successfully for U.S. Senate. Garrity vastly outraised her Democratic opponent, receiving nearly $1.7 million in donations through Oct. 21 of this year.
